    We had heard that the "Diner" inside the Tamarack was pretty good, so we wanted to give it a try. I would day that the food on our visit was "okay". A highlight of our visit was our waitress, Christina. Her brutal honesty and upbeat demeanor was a true treat. She gave us guidance on best plates with a refreshing sense of honesty that we loved. I had the Chicken Enchilada Plate. To be fair, I think it would have been better if it hadn't been sitting under the heating lamps for so long. That said the Enchilada's were "okay", nothing amazing but the green chile sauce was actually quite good. The Pinto beans were pretty good but the spanish rice was a bit over cooked from the heating lamps. My wife had the burger. I thought it was pretty good. The bun was tasty but not oversided. Just right. The patty was cooked and tasty. The burger was served with fries that were absolutely delicious. For simple diner food, that is close by, the DC Cafe is a decent option. We'll definitely be coming back to try more of the menu.

    Back in 2021 when the DC Cafe at the Tamarack Casino first opened, I gave them a bad, one star review. Now in November 2024, I have to say the place has improved considerably. I live about 5 minutes away from the Tamarack, so I go there often. My favorite side of the DC Cafe is the Sport's Bar. It is cozy, it has plenty of large screen TVs and offers great customer service. The menu has been expanded with many great food choices at very reasonable prices. If you like domestic beers and wine like I do, you can find them here for $4, $5 dollars. I highly recommend the place for a good meal (breakfast, lunch, dinner) and/or sports watching.

    Working up in Truckee, I am always interacting with a lot of international students. There was a group of girls from malaysia in town, and I brought them to Reno for a casino/an expensive meal. I love DC café because they have a lot of $6.99 and $7.99 specials. And quite a few dinners under $10. We arrived near closing, however they have a policy of seating up to the last minute lol. We took two of the half booth half tables and I ordered my usual Cadillac margarita. Matt was our waiter. He's always an awesome guy. What we ordered: Cadillac margarita 4x pork medallions with mashed potatoes and vegetables Grilled salmon Tried to order chili Verde but they were out of it Chicken enchiladas Chicken burrito Chicken fried steak and eggs over easy The food arrived promptly. The girls enjoyed the dinner so much, there was not a crumb or speck of food left on the plates lol. They have been in the US for about two months and mostly been eating as cheap as possible, which is difficult to do in Truckee. so they really enjoyed a home-cooked meal even if it was American style. Really enjoyed the meal. The service was great. The prices are great. We will definitely be back.
